3)Kristina Gulley, former Justice of the Peace for District 10, was prohibited from holding office following the revelation of past convictions for issuing hot checks in 1997 and 2003. Under Article 5, Section 9 of the Arkansas Constitution, individuals convicted of “infamous crimes” involving deceit or dishonesty are barred from running for public office.
